The Russian Navy will receive another three Krivak IV Class frigates from United Shipbuilding following an agreement between the company and the Defence Ministry.

Designed as a successor to the Riga Class frigate, the Krivak IV Class warship is outfitted with a Shtil medium-range air defence system, two Kashtan point defence systems and an anti-submarine warfare helicopter.
The Krivak IV Class vessel is also equipped with a 100mm gun, Club-N supersonic anti-ship missiles and two twin 533mm torpedo launchers, according to RIA Novosti.
Scheduled for construction by 2016, the new frigates are expected to be deployed with Moscow’s Black Sea Fleet based on the Crimean peninsula.
